深入解析MCF5213 ColdFire微控制器:特性、电气规格与应用潜力
引言
在嵌入式系统开发领域,选择一款合适的微控制器至关重要。Freescale Semiconductor的MCF5213 ColdFire微控制器以其高性能、低功耗和丰富的外设功能,成为众多工程师的理想之选。本文将深入剖析MCF5213的特性、电气规格等关键信息,为电子工程师在设计应用中提供全面的参考。
文件下载:MCF5212LCVM80.pdf
MCF5213家族概述
家族配置
MCF5213属于ColdFire®系列精简指令集计算(RISC)微处理器家族。该家族包含MCF5211、MCF5212和MCF5213等型号,它们在性能、内存配置和外设功能上存在差异。例如,MCF5213具有高达256 Kbytes的闪存和32 Kbytes的静态随机存取存储器(SRAM),而MCF5211只有128/16 Kbytes的闪存/SRAM。在性能方面,MCF5213在80 MHz运行时可达到76 MIPS(Dhrystone 2.1),表现更为出色。
特性概览
- V2 ColdFire处理器核心:采用可变长度RISC架构,具备静态操作能力,32位地址和数据路径,最高可达80 MHz的处理器核心频率。拥有十六个通用32位数据和地址寄存器,实现了ColdFire ISA_A+指令集,支持用户堆栈指针寄存器和四个新的位处理指令。此外,还集成了乘法累加(MAC)单元,可进行16×16→32或32×32→32的运算,提升了信号处理能力。
- 系统调试支持:提供实时跟踪功能,可确定动态执行路径;具备背景调试模式(BDM),支持在线调试;拥有六个硬件断点,可配置为1级或2级触发,实现实时调试。
- 片上存储器:32 - Kbyte双端口SRAM可由CPU核心和DMA访问,支持待机电源供应;256 Kbytes的交错闪存支持2 - 1 - 1 - 1访问,适用于存储关键代码和数据。
- 电源管理:支持处理器睡眠和全芯片停止模式,可从低功耗睡眠模式快速响应中断。每个外设可独立启用或禁用时钟,降低功耗。
- FlexCAN 2.0B模块:基于Freescale TouCAN模块,完全实现CAN协议规范2.0B,支持标准和扩展数据及远程帧,具备灵活的消息缓冲区,可配置为接收或发送模式,还支持监听模式。
- 通信接口:拥有三个通用异步/同步收发器(UARTs)、I²C模块、排队串行外设接口(QSPI),满足不同的通信需求。
- 定时器和ADC:四个32位定时器支持DMA,四个通道的通用定时器可实现输入捕获、输出比较和脉宽调制(PWM)功能;八通道12位快速模数转换器(ADC),转换时间短,可同时采样两个通道。
引脚功能与信号说明
引脚配置
MCF5213提供多种封装选项,包括LQFP - 64、MAPBGA - 81、LQFP - 100和QFN - 64。不同封装的引脚配置有所不同,每个引脚都有其主要和备用功能。例如,ADC引脚可作为模拟输入,也可作为通用I/O使用;I²C引脚用于芯片间通信;UART引脚用于串行数据传输等。
信号功能
文档详细列出了各种信号的功能和I/O类型,如复位信号(RSTI和RSTO)用于芯片复位;PLL和时钟信号(EXTAL、XTAL、CLKOUT)支持片上时钟生成;模式选择信号(CLKMOD[1:0]、RCON、TEST)用于选择时钟模式和进入特定功能模式。
电气特性
最大额定值
MCF5213的电源电压范围为 - 0.3至 + 4.0 V,时钟合成器电源电压和RAM待机电源电压也在相同范围内。数字输入电压范围为 - 0.3至 + 4.0 V,EXTAL和XTAL引脚电压范围为0至3.3 V。最大瞬时电流为25 mA,工作温度范围为 - 40至85 °C,存储温度范围为 - 65至150 °C。
电流消耗
在不同的工作模式下,MCF5213的电流消耗有所不同。例如,在停止模式下,电流消耗最低可达0.13 mA;在运行模式下,随着系统时钟频率的增加,电流消耗也会相应增加。
热特性
不同封装的热特性存在差异,如100 LQFP封装在自然对流下,结到环境的热阻为39 °C/W(四层板);81 MAPBGA封装在自然对流下,结到环境的热阻为35 °C/W(四层板)。了解热特性有助于工程师在设计散热方案时做出合理的决策。
闪存特性
闪存的系统时钟在只读模式下最高可达66.67或80 MHz,在编程/擦除模式下为0.15至66.67或80 MHz。闪存模块的最大编程/擦除周期为10,000次,在85°C的平均工作温度下,数据保留时间为10年。
ESD保护
MCF5213具备ESD保护功能,人体模型(HBM)的ESD目标为2000 V,机器模型(MM)的ESD目标为200 V。
直流电气规格
电源电压范围为3.0至3.6 V,输入高电压为0.7 × VDD至4.0 V,输入低电压为VSS - 0.3至0.35 × VDD,输入滞后为0.06 × VDD mV。
时钟源电气规格
PLL参考频率范围为2至10.0 MHz,系统频率在外部时钟模式下为0至fref / 32,在片上PLL模式下为66.67或80 MHz。
定时规格
文档还提供了GPIO、复位、I²C、ADC、DMA定时器、QSPI、JTAG和调试等方面的定时规格,确保系统在不同操作下的稳定性和准确性。
机械外形
文档给出了64 - pin LQFP、64 QFN、81 MAPBGA和100 - pin LQFP等不同封装的机械外形图,包括尺寸、公差和引脚布局等信息,方便工程师进行PCB设计。
应用建议与思考
应用场景
MCF5213适用于多种应用场景,如工业控制、汽车电子、通信设备等。其丰富的外设功能和高性能处理能力,能够满足不同应用的需求。例如,在工业控制中,FlexCAN模块可用于实现可靠的通信;在汽车电子中,ADC可用于采集传感器数据。
设计注意事项
在设计过程中,工程师需要注意电源管理,合理配置时钟模式以降低功耗;关注引脚的复用功能,避免信号冲突;根据热特性设计合适的散热方案,确保芯片在正常温度范围内工作。同时,要严格遵守最大额定值,避免因电压、电流等参数超出范围而损坏芯片。
总结
MCF5213 ColdFire微控制器以其强大的功能、丰富的外设和良好的电气特性,为电子工程师提供了一个优秀的设计平台。通过深入了解其特性和规格,工程师可以充分发挥其优势,设计出高性能、低功耗的嵌入式系统。在实际应用中,还需要结合具体需求进行合理的配置和优化,以实现最佳的性能和可靠性。你在使用MCF5213或其他类似微控制器时,遇到过哪些挑战呢?欢迎在评论区分享你的经验和见解。
-
嵌入式系统
+关注
关注
41文章
3817浏览量
133864 -
MCF5213
+关注
关注
0文章
5浏览量
7369
发布评论请先 登录
深入解析MCF5213 ColdFire微控制器:特性、电气规格与应用潜力
评论